Mucuna Pruriens

Mucuna pruriens is a tropical legume known for its high concentration of L-DOPA, a precursor to the neurotransmitter dopamine. It is used in supplements to support mood, motivation, and hormonal health, especially in the context of fitness and stress management.

For physically active individuals, Mucuna may help improve focus, mental drive, and resilience to stress. Its influence on dopamine can support a positive mindset, which is beneficial for training consistency and motivation.

Additionally, Mucuna has been explored for its potential effects on testosterone levels, although findings are mixed and require further validation.

Synonyms:

Velvet bean, Cowhage, Kapikacchu

Benefits:

  • Natural source of L-DOPA (dopamine precursor)
  • Supports mood and motivation
  • May aid in stress resilience and mental focus
  • Possible testosterone support

Sources:

Found in tropical regions; seeds are processed into extract for supplement use.

Observations:

Used in powder or capsule form. Excessive intake may cause nausea or overstimulation. Can interact with medications affecting dopamine levels (e.g., for Parkinson’s disease).
